The Huge Gap that College Bound Student's Fall lnto (three parts- not necessary to be at all three) 

There is an abyss for homeschoolers when it comes to preparing and paying for higher education, thus leaving families at a loss without proper guidance.

Having no “guidance counselor” can cause families to believe they are missing an important component in the college preparation journey. The truth is, that it’s not the job of the school counselor to get students into college but rather to get them out of high school. Without proper training, they often give wrong information about testing or applications that can ultimately cost a student admittance and scholarship money. On the contrary, it’s not the college admission’s counselors’ job to get a student through high school but to admit them to the school. 

Herein lies the chasm that most families, from all schools, face when it comes to college preparation. Consequently, numerous college planning companies cropped up over the years to fill in the gap. These businesses specialize in hand-holding students to write an essay, complete an application and fill out the FAFSA and they generally come with a big price tag, often several thousands of dollars. 

The good news for SUHC families is that Jean Burk will share with you a step-by-step guide for college-bound students—all for FREE! N

     Tj Schmidt

Can Homeschooling Really Prepare Your Child for Life/Career? Tj will encourage parents (and teens) through his personal experiences of how homeschooling can prepare your child for a successful future and life in general. It was homeschooling that brought Tj to live in Haiti and the Dominican Republic, help his father build over eight houses, sail through the Caribbean, work through law school at home and eventually come to work at Home School Legal Defense Association (HSLDA). Tj will also give a couple of examples of other homeschool success stories while providing helpful tips on what you can do to prepare your children for success through homeschooling. N

Homeschooling? How to Get Started and Stand Firm. In this workshop Tj will walk you through pulling out from public school or starting your homeschool program at kindergarten. While the focus will be on Utah homeschool law, the discussion may include Arizona and/or Nevada if appropriate. This workshop will also cover how to deal with questions from local school officials, social services, or others. Tj will educate you to be better prepared to handle these situations as well as how to get the help you may need in the future. A few common homeschool scenarios will be discussed. There may be time for questions and answers at the end.  N
